Warby Parker is seeking a data-driven, experienced Production Supervisor for our in-house optical manufacturing facility in Las Vegas, NV. This role oversees 1st shift production, leading a team in a fast-paced, rapidly growing environment.
Responsibilities
- Supervise 15+ hourly employees in a specific manufacturing department
- Deliver regular feedback, mentor through one-on-ones and quarterly check-ins, and identify development opportunities
- Communicate daily production goals and metrics, maintaining accountability for throughput and performance
- Identify new ways to streamline processes in your department
- Ensure safety practices are followed and conduct job-specific trainings
- Partner with the Production Manager to identify strengths and opportunities for each Associate’s continued success
- Lead by example, continuously coaching and promoting accountability
- Conduct trainings, coaching, and monitoring using functional knowledge of all lab positions
- Direct Associates to lend support in other departments as needed
- Drive production to meet or exceed specified goals
- Maintain safety standards, monitor breakage, and provide timely feedback
Requirements
- 3+ years of work experience, including at least 12 months of production experience in a leadership role
- Experience leading or managing a team or project
- Strong work ethic and willingness to do what it takes to get the job done right
- Excellent communication skills (in person, email, etc.)
- Obsessive attention to detail
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ced environment
- Able to stand and/or walk for 8-10 hours and perform physical tasks (push, pull, squat, bend, reach) with or without reasonable accommodation
